  3. Engine Health Check, compression, etc

    by , 07-03-2013 at 10:37 PM (Today at Atelier Kaz - Private NSX Enthusiast, ex-Honda R&D engineer with F1, Indy/CART background)



    At the time of annual service, I recommend the owner to
    carry out the compression check.
    This will at least confirm the condition of the upper part of
    your engine and by building up the compression history,
    you may be able to spot the sign of issue.

    It will also help if you keep monitoring the fuel mileage
    every time when you fill up your tank.
